Retracing behavior of phase matching has been observed in the generati
on of infrared radiation (1.25-1.85 mum) by both type-I angle-tuned an
d temperature-tuned difference frequency mixing of a Nd:YAG laser (106
4 nm) with its second-harmonic pumped dye laser (570-675 nm) in lithiu
m triborate crystal. Large spectral acceptance of 49 nm at spectral no
ncritical phase-matching point and angular acceptance of 4.0-degrees a
t angular noncritical phase-matching point has been obtained.
